Dr. Daniel Krone is a senior associate in the Firm’s Information Technology Practice Group. Located in Munich, Dr. Krone advises national and international clients, particularly those in the technology, communications and media industries. Dr. Krone has written and co-authored various books and articles in his field, and has taught media law at universities in Muenster, Osnabrueck, Moscow and Paris.
Practice Focus
Dr. Krone advises on all aspects of information technology and digital media. His practice includes acting for clients in relation to outsourcing and technology deals, software contracts and implementations, content licensing and regulation, e-commerce and data privacy. Dr. Krone is also experienced in the field of broadcasting and youth protection.
Representative Legal Matters
- Acted on behalf of a DAX 30 company on structuring and negotiating an ITO and related subcontract worth over EUR1 billion.
- Advised a Fortune 50 company on developing and implementing a world-wide privacy solution for employee data transfers made by several hundred business entities.
- Acted on behalf of a well-known lifestyle and fashion company on establishing a whistleblowing hotline in 53 countries.
- Advised a leading technology company in relation to a security breach involving data of more than 100 million customers.
- Advised the non-profit organizations PILI and IREX pro bono in relation to developing freedom of information laws in Nepal and Georgia.
